    Push press is a great plateau buster. If your max strict form press has been the same for a while, put an extra 20lbs on the bar and do some push presses. After a few weeks of consistent push pressing you'll find you can do that extra 20lbs even with strict form. Rinse repeat.

    @@Mks25932 I disagree I find the hardest part of the strict press is between your chin and your eye level. The first and last 6 inches are easy it's that bit in the middle about face height that's the hard part. That's no man's land where your back is doing less of the work but your triceps aren't in an optimal position to take over. I find heavy push press helps me break into new highs, and then I can back fill that with strict reps after a couple of months. I'm up to a few reps at 100kg with strict form, and that's with these really long Tarzan arms, so I'm doing something right.
